Output e60ef2795822f6c619ec3ad2dbd8c8d47188530f16aecaecb0e63bb8cfd9c7a9:2

value
924078
script pubkey
OP_0 OP_PUSHBYTES_20 3907d93c3009987cf4480c7df5d7632ff37ac83a
address
bc1q8yraj0pspxv8eazgp37lt4mr9leh4jp6fhnlkp
transaction
e60ef2795822f6c619ec3ad2dbd8c8d47188530f16aecaecb0e63bb8cfd9c7a9
confirmations
2063
spent
false

1 Sat Range